    <title>2025 (10) TMI 1331 - ITAT MUMBAI</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=465187</link>
    <description>The ITAT Mumbai dismissed the assessee&#039;s miscellaneous application as barred by limitation under section 254(2) of the Income-tax Act. The Tribunal held that rectification of any mistake apparent from the record must be undertaken within six months from the end of the month in which the original order is passed. Since the Tribunal&#039;s order was dated 13.08.2024 and the assessee filed the miscellaneous application on 09.04.2025, it fell beyond the prescribed six-month period. Consequently, the application was held to be time-barred and was rejected as unadmitted, with no examination of the merits of the alleged mistake.</description>
